Abstract
Aqueous solutions of linoleic acid were irradiated in air with gamma -rays of Cs-137. High pressure liquid chromatography (HPLC) was been used to sepa rate and measure the production of hydroperoxides. The results obtained aft er reverse phase chromatography, associated with a microperoxydase for hydr operoxide detection, indicate the presence of two different hydroperoxides. One type of hydroperoxide was the major product obtained when the initial linoleic concentrations were below the critical micellar concentration (2 m M), and the second type was produced when the concentrations were above 2 m M. A further separation carried out on the second hydroperoxide by direct p hase HPLC showed that it contains three compounds, mainly HPODE 9 and 13.
